What to Know Before Visiting a School

Visitors to Williamson County schools will need to go through a specific process when entering a school building. A new visitor check-in system was implemented across the district last school year and will continue into the 2026-27 school year.

As in years past, all visitors will need their driver's license or photo ID to enter the building. After entering the front office, visitors will stop at the electronic kiosk and select "Visitors" to start the process.

  1. Select "Check In" and take a photo. After taking the photo, select "Close."

  2. Hold the driver's license in front of the camera located on the back of the iPad and take a photo. Flip the driver's license over to scan the bar code.
  3. Select the destination and type the first name of the person they are here to see.
  4. Select "Check In" one final time to print a visitor badge. 

Each school office will have someone available to assist visitors with the check-in process.
